In summary

Brentwood Central is in the less-deprived top third of England, ranked #1,897 of 6,856 neighbourhoods nationally, and #5 of 9 in Brentwood. It is highly uneven across the seven themes — strong on Housing & access (84) but weak on Crime (29). Typical homes here sold for about £357,500 over the past year, down 1% across five years (from 220 sales), 28% below the wider Brentwood median of £500,000. Typical household take-home income is around £49,555 a year, in the top third of England. Recorded crime ran at 130 incidents per 1,000 residents over the past year, above the England rate of 83.

Recorded incidents, not convictions. Crimes are counted where they happen while residents are counted where they live, so busy town-centre, retail and nightlife areas show high per-resident rates because visitors bring incidents with them.
